A shimmer dupatta is a must-have for any bride-to-be, adding an extra layer of glamour to her wedding outfit. Pair your Gulbhahar dupatta with a classic red lehenga or opt for something more contemporary like a blush pink one Lehenga Voni Designs for a romantic look. To complete the ensemble, add some statement earrings and a matching maang tikka to draw attention to your face.

Inject some elegance into your office wardrobe by incorporating a shimmer dupatta into your professional attire. A subtle gold or silver thread work can be worn over a simple white kurti paired with wide-legged pants Full Sleeve Salwar Suit Design. The dupatta not only adds a touch of sophistication but also ensures you stay comfortable throughout the day. Keep your accessories minimal, opting for simple stud earrings and a pearl necklace.
When attending weddings as a guest, it's all about striking that perfect balance between elegance and respect. A Gulbhahar shimmer dupatta can be draped over an elegant saree or paired with a classic lehenga Dupatta Attached Lehenga for a sophisticated yet graceful look. Choose pastel hues like mint green, baby blue, or soft pink to ensure your outfit stands out without overshadowing the bride. Complete your look with a gold bangle set and some sleek heels for an impeccable finish.
